神经网络模型在自然语言生成中的应用

魔法使者 2022-08-16 ⋅ 17 阅读

随着人工智能技术的不断进步,神经网络模型在各个领域中得到了广泛的应用,其中自然语言生成是其中之一。自然语言生成(Natural Language Generation, NLG)是指计算机系统通过学习和理解自然语言规则,生成符合人类习惯和逻辑的自然语言文本。

神经网络模型基础

神经网络模型是一种类似于人脑神经系统的计算机模型,由一系列的神经元和各种连接构成。在自然语言处理中,常用的神经网络模型包括循环神经网络 (Recurrent Neural Network, RNN) 和变种长短时记忆网络 (Long Short-Term Memory, LSTM)。

RNN和LSTM是两种常见的用于处理自然语言序列数据的神经网络模型。RNN通过在网络中引入循环连接,使得网络可以更好地捕捉序列之间的依赖关系,LSTM则通过引入记忆单元和门控机制,解决了传统RNN在长序列处理中的梯度消失和梯度爆炸问题。

神经网络模型在自然语言生成中的应用

文本摘要生成

文本摘要生成是自然语言生成的一个重要应用场景。通过神经网络模型,可以将一篇长文本自动摘要为简洁且能够概括原文核心内容的摘要。

神经网络模型通过对训练数据的学习,能够理解和提取关键信息,同时生成更加流畅和准确的文本摘要。这种自动生成的文本摘要可以被广泛应用于新闻媒体、智能助手等领域。

对话系统

神经网络模型也在对话系统中发挥着重要的作用。通过建模对话系统中的上下文信息,神经网络模型能够生成智能的对话回复。

在训练过程中,可以使用大量的对话数据对神经网络模型进行训练。训练完成后,模型可以生成与人类对话风格相似的回复,并进行上下文的理解和延续。

机器翻译

机器翻译是自然语言处理中的重要任务之一,通过将一种语言的文本转换为另一种语言的文本。

神经网络模型在机器翻译中取得了显著的成果,尤其是基于序列到序列模型(Sequence-to-Sequence, Seq2Seq)的变种模型,如基于注意力机制的Transformer模型。

这些神经网络模型能够进行有效的语言表达和表示学习,从而实现更准确和流畅的机器翻译。

文章创作辅助

神经网络模型可以用于文章创作辅助,帮助用户自动生成流畅、可读性较高的文本。

通过对已有的文章进行学习,神经网络模型可以学习到文章的结构、内容和表达方式,并能够生成与输入主题相关的文章段落。

这种应用使得用户可以快速生成大量的文本内容,提高了文章创作的效率。

总结

神经网络模型在自然语言生成中的应用非常广泛。从文本摘要生成、对话系统、机器翻译到文章创作辅助,神经网络模型通过模拟人脑的工作机制,能够有效地生成符合人类语言规则和习惯的自然语言文本。

随着神经网络模型的不断发展和改进,相信其在自然语言生成领域的应用会有更广阔的空间,为人工智能的智能化和自动化提供更多的可能性。


全部评论: 0

    我有话说: